dogsภาษาอังกฤษSLแปลว่า สนามแข่งสุนัขเกรย์ฮาวนด์แปลว่า สุดยอด, เยี่ยมยอด ภาพประกอบ dogs คำศัพท์ภาษาอังกฤษที่คล้ายกันdab offdabble indaddy of them alldaily dozendam updogs bollocks(fucking dogs) get stuckgo to the dogsrain cats and dogsthe dogsthe dogs bollocksthrow something to the dogs